Career Roles in Media Consumption Ethics and Regulation

  • Media Ethics Consultant: Advises organizations on ethical media practices, ensuring compliance with regulations and industry standards.
  • Regulatory Compliance Officer: Ensures that media organizations adhere to laws and regulations, mitigating legal risks.
  • Digital Content Manager: Oversees the creation and management of digital media content while prioritizing ethical considerations.
  • Media Policy Analyst: Researches and analyzes media policies, assessing their impact on consumption and regulation.
  • Social Media Strategist: Develops strategies for ethical social media engagement, focusing on audience trust and regulatory compliance.
  • Audience Research Specialist: Conducts studies to understand audience consumption patterns and ethical implications.
  • Content Quality Assessor: Evaluates media content for ethical standards and regulatory compliance, ensuring high-quality delivery.
